Myrtle Beach State Park spans over 300 acres of coastal land, providing a serene retreat away from the boardwalk and tourist hotspots. As you step foot onto the park's sandy shores, you'll be greeted by the sound of crashing waves and the salty scent of the Atlantic Ocean. This beach stretches for a mile, inviting visitors to bask in the sun, build sandcastles, or take a refreshing dip in the warm waters. With ample space and less crowded conditions compared to neighboring beaches, Myrtle Beach State Park offers a tranquil setting for a day of relaxation and leisure.
Beyond its sandy beaches, the park boasts a diverse range of ecosystems that showcase the region's natural splendor. As you venture inland, you'll discover lush maritime forests, freshwater ponds, and salt marshes teeming with life. The park's boardwalks and nature trails allow visitors to immerse themselves in this ecological wonderland, where they can spot a wide variety of wildlife and plants Keep an eye out for unique plant species like the wax myrtle and Southern magnolia, and be sure to listen for the songs of migratory birds that call the park home.
For those seeking a closer connection, Myrtle Beach State Park offers an array of camping options. Whether you prefer a tent, RV, or cabin, there are accommodations to suit every camping style. The park features well-maintained campsites with amenities such as picnic tables, grills, and restroom facilities. Camping at Myrtle Beach State Park allows you to wake up to the sounds of nature, enjoy breathtaking sunsets.
Apart from camping, the park offers a range of recreational activities for visitors of all ages. From fishing off the pier to kayaking in the park's freshwater ponds or simply strolling along the picturesque trails, there's something for everyone to enjoy. Birdwatching and biking are also popular pastimes in the park, ensuring that each visit is special.
